This black-and-white print shows two people walking through a wooded area. One person is bent over, carrying something heavy on their back, while the other walks beside them, also burdened. The trees and bushes are drawn with sharp, detailed lines, and a small house with a thatched roof sits in the background. The artist used quick, sketchy strokes to show movement and exhaustion.
